## Deployment: Zero-Downtime Schema Migrations

Welcome aboard. The Cartwheel service never takes a maintenance window, so every schema change must follow the expand-contract pattern: add new columns first, deploy code that writes to both old and new, backfill, then remove the old path in a later release. Never combine an expand and a contract in one deploy — that is how outages happen here. The migration runner enforces ordering and lock timeouts, and it is configured in production with the values below.

config for bawig-fadup:
[zorix]
host = zorix.lumicworks.corp
user = zorix_svc
database = zorix_prod

## Further reading

So the Quillhaven reindex kicked over at 02:00 and you're wondering what it actually does — fair. Short version: it rebuilds the product search shards from the Copperfield snapshot, swaps aliases, then prunes old segments. Most pages trace back to a stuck alias swap. The architecture notes and common failure modes live on the internal page.

runbook for tafof-yawif: https://confluence.tolvaqsys.internal/display/display/browse/pages/7be3

= Hedging Decision: Tarwick Analytics (Managers Only) =

For the incoming director: this page records the rationale behind Tarwick Analytics' decision to hedge 60% of euro-denominated exposure through the fiscal year. The treasury committee weighed forward contracts against options and chose forwards for cost certainty. Review the sensitivity tables before the quarterly sign-off, as assumptions are conservative. The connection to our wider commercial strategy is summarised in the note below.

board note of kagup-tawif: Sorionax Logistics is in early talks to buy Praaelax Group for about $53.1 million. The Kelmir launch date is March 20, and nothing goes to the press before then.